Potentiometer





1. Remove sealing compound from potentiometer attachment screws.
2. Loosen screws so that they secure the potentiometer, but allow it to be adjusted.
3. Lift the sensor plate up so that it is even with the bottom edge of the venturi cone (use special tool VW 1348/1, or some other fixture that will allow the sensor plate to remain stationary while performing adjustment).
4. With test harness and engine harness connected, switch ignition ON.
5. Adjust potentiometer so that voltage reading shows 0.2 - 0.3 vdc, then tighten attachment screws.
6. With sensor plate lifted up to its' stop, voltage should be approx. 7 vdc.
7. Seal screws with paint or original type sealing compound.
